Attached. I've deleted all entries in the FORMATS section except for that to xfig, since something extra is needed to start up X11. However, I'm not sure that I'm doing it correctly. open-x11 is supposed to start up X11.app, which is the GUI for the X server, and previously open-x11 would work on its own. Now (at least on my Intel Mac) open-x11 does nothing unless you give it a program to run. That program can't be xfig, since then DISPLAY isn't set and so it won't open the file from LyX. So I have it set to open X (which then fails, since X11.app has already opened X), after which it can set DISPLAY and so open xfig. Is that the right thing to do?
